Hi Euan,
I had the same problem as you a few months ago when I played with a digitizer with huge memory. What I did is just removing the macro MAX_ARRAY_SIZE and its associated codes from aSubRecord.c so that there won't be any limit on the array size. I have not seen any problem with this change since.

Subject: aSub MAX_ARRAY_SIZE increase
Hi tech-talk,
I have an EPICS application that runs on Linux/Darwin where I need to increase the value of MAX_ARRAY_SIZE in aSubRecord.c from ten million to 200 million or possibly even 1000 million. Apart from creating a version of EPICS that is only locally compatible (and needing lots of memory to run) are there any likely problems with this change?
